Hypnosis has a mixed history which creates mixed feelings in people. Nowadays hypnosis is a recognised field of study leading even to medical qualifications. Scientists have proved that hypnosis does have an effect on the way our brain processes commands and suggestions. Even despite all this, many people still have misconceptions and fears concerning the reputation of hypnosis and rumours of thought control still circulate nowadays. The stage magician with his "power" over subjects has left some people with a mistrust of hypnosis, others with a kind of dread fascination.

Hypnosis can be done in two ways:

Progressive Relaxation (or PR) which is used by the majority of medical practitioners qualified in the use of hypnotherapy. This method uses a gentle form of soothing or relaxation to ease the subject into a hypnotic state. It can take 30 minutes or more before the subject reaches the end of the third or deepening phase.

Rapid Induction (or RI) is generally used more for stage hypnosis or other instances where the subject has to reach a deepened hypnotic state in a short period of time. Using this method involves the use of the subject's mental anticipation combined with some type of shock to the subject. This method can be used to induce hypnosis in only a few seconds.

Hypnosis can be induced using "mind machines" involving LED equipped glasses and audio tapes. Audio tapes on their own can be used to relax a person or produce binaural beats thereby inducing a hypnotic state. Binaural beats according to scientific evidence produce sounds on slightly different frequencies that when heard through stereo headphones produce a beating sound apparently from the brain itself that produces a deeply relaxed pre-hypnotic state in the subject. These binaural beats are often combined with music in order to induce a hypnotic state and sold as relaxation tapes, some are available free on the internet and can be found when you search online for free hypnosis audio files downloads. Hypnosis May Help Lessen Hot Flashes (ThirdAge)

U.S. researchers suggest hypnotic relaxation therapy may help decrease hot flashes in menopausal women. The effects of hot flashes -- such as loss of sleep -- also significantly decreased in the majority of women receiving hypnosis, says lead investigator Gary Elkins of Baylor University, Waco, Texas.

Hypnosis, Memory and the Brain (Scientific American)

Hypnosis has long been considered a valuable technique for recreating and then studying puzzling psychological phenomena. A classic example of this approach uses a technique known as posthypnotic amnesia (PHA) to model memory disorders such as functional amnesia, which involves a sudden memory loss typically due to some sort of psychological trauma (rather than to brain damage or disease). ...
